    Confectionery firm Mars is shrinking the pack size of favourite sweets including Maltesers, M&M’s and Minstrels by up to 15% in the latest example of an industry trend that is shortchanging shoppers.

    It is the second time within a year that Mars has reduced the number of Maltesers in its sharing bags, which now weigh in at just 93g. Last autumn packs of Maltesers, billed as the lighter way to enjoy chocolate, shrank from 121g to 103g.

    The American food giant appears to have taken action across its bestselling brands: family packs of M&M’s are now 25g lighter at 140g, while bags of Minstrels and Revels are also almost 10% lighter. Prices are unchanged.

    American owned company shrinking packs here while pack sizes there are colossal. I bet the prices won't shrink, as usual...

    To be fair they manufacture it in the UK, they import a lot of ingredients and sterling has taken a hammering recently. There's been inflation and wages in real terms are going down at the moment.

    So if they increase the price but keep the same size they'll find a drop in units sold. But if they drop the size they can probably manage to keep sales up. They probably have loads of research on price points, consumer perceptions etc...
